Farnaz Murdered by Mahboud, Niavaran, Iran

Case Summary

On September 5, 2022, Farnaz, a 25-year-old woman, was fatally stabbed 26 times in a villa in Niavaran, Tehran. The incident was reported by Iman, a 70-year-old man engaged to Farnaz. The perpetrator, Mahboud, a former friend and suitor of Farnaz, was identified through CCTV and phone records. Mahboud confessed to the murder, citing betrayal and jealousy after discovering Farnaz's relationship with Iman, an older man. Mahboud was arrested, tried, sentenced to death, and executed in early 2025. The case involved complex relationship dynamics including a significant age gap, secretive relationships, and jealousy.

Investigative Notes

Police confirmed the suspect's identity via CCTV and phone records. Mahboud was arrested after a manhunt and confessed. The victim's family demanded retribution. The case proceeded to trial, resulting in a death sentence confirmed by the Supreme Court. The investigation included forensic analysis, phone data examination, and suspect interrogation.

Investigation Confusion

Initial confusion due to Iman's unclear phone report and lack of knowledge about Farnaz's family and contacts. Uncertainty about Mahboud's whereabouts delayed arrest. No confusion about suspect identity after confession.

Case Reconstruction / Puzzle Pieces

Iman and Farnaz met six months prior and became engaged via temporary marriage. Farnaz maintained a prior friendship and suitor relationship with Mahboud, who became suspicious after Farnaz started working and acquiring assets. On the incident day, Mahboud followed Farnaz to Iman's house, entered under false pretenses, and fatally stabbed her. Iman witnessed part of the event and reported it. Police used CCTV and phone records to identify and arrest Mahboud, who confessed and was sentenced to death.
